Product

Problem

Individuals and families often struggle to keep critical financial records—bank credentials, cryptocurrency wallet metadata, property deeds, and personal instructions—securely organized while also ensuring that trusted contacts can access them in emergencies or after the owner's death. Traditional password managers either store full credentials in the cloud or lack automated inheritance mechanisms, creating both security and continuity gaps.

Solution

Safecho delivers a local‑first, zero‑knowledge vault that encrypts all asset “clues” on the user’s device, never persisting plain‑text keys, passwords, or recovery phrases. Users define delayed triggers based on inactivity periods or manual confirmation, enabling automatic activation of inheritance or emergency access plans without manual intervention. Multi‑party authorization requires verification from multiple designated contacts before any data is released, reducing the risk of unauthorized disclosure. Granular access controls let owners specify exactly which records each beneficiary can view, supporting both privacy and transparency. The platform supports a wide range of asset types—including bank accounts, investment portfolios, crypto wallet metadata, and legal documents—allowing a single, unified repository for all legacy information. All data is transmitted over end‑to‑end encrypted channels and stored locally with optional encrypted backups, eliminating reliance on persistent cloud storage.

Features

  • Military‑grade (AES‑256) encryption performed client‑side; encryption keys never leave the device (zero‑knowledge architecture)
  • Local‑first storage model with optional encrypted backup, ensuring full data custody without permanent cloud dependencies
  • “Clue‑only” storage that records metadata and access instructions while never storing private keys, seed phrases, or API secrets in plaintext
  • Configurable delayed trigger engine that activates after a user‑defined inactivity window or upon manual confirmation for inheritance or emergency scenarios
  • Multi‑party authorization workflow requiring consensus from two or more trusted contacts before any record is decrypted and shared
  • Granular permission matrix allowing per‑record view/edit rights for each designated beneficiary or emergency contact
  • Comprehensive asset coverage UI for banking, investment, cryptocurrency, property deeds, and custom personal notes
  • Independent verification layer that cross‑checks identity, intent, and authorization steps to mitigate misuse or accidental release
